Question
Canavan disease is a genetic condition brought about by a fault in the gene coding for the enzyme aspartoacylase. This enzyme normally breaks down a substance in the brain called N-acetyl-aspartate (NAA). Research indicates that when NAA fails to be broken down, the resulting imbalance of chemicals disrupts the building of the myelin sheath while the nervous system is forming. (a) Explain how a fault in the gene leads to too little of the enzyme being made.
Worked answer
The gene carries the sequence of bases (code) that determines the sequence of amino acids in the aspartoacylase enzyme. A fault (mutation) changes the base sequence, so the correct amino acid sequence cannot be assembled. As a result the enzyme is not made correctly / not made in sufficient amounts, so too little functional enzyme is produced.
